Ryan Smee is a Senior Frontend Engineer based in the Greater Cambridge area with nine years of experience building user-focused web and VR interfaces. He combines startup grit—co-founding and exiting Safepoint in 2022—with senior engineering roles at SourceBreaker and now SideQuest VR, blending product intuition with hands-on frontend craft. His open-source contributions include substantial work on the ngneat/falso fake-data library, where he implemented feature-rich text and entity generators and improved test coverage and code organization. Comfortable across the full front-end stack, he brings practical UX sensibility from early freelance design work through to shipping complex VR-facing experiences. Colleagues describe him as a pragmatic problem-solver who bridges product and engineering to ship polished, testable front-end systems.

Contributions summary:Ryan primarily contributed to the `falso` library by implementing and refactoring features, adding unit tests, and improving code organization. Their work included updating the `rgb()` function to dynamically generate RGB strings, incorporating a shared `getRandomInRange` function, and adding new functions for text generation (including character counts and text ranges). Furthermore, they were involved in adding functions related to text and entity generation like airport, credit card, and flight details.
